Picking the appropriate stationary bicycle is important to make sure a comfortable and reliable workout experience. Here are some aspects to consider:
Type of Bike
Upright Bike: Resembles a conventional roadway bike and provides a more intense exercise.
Recumbent Bike: Provides back support and is perfect for those with neck and back pain or mobility concerns.
Spin Bike: Designed for high-intensity interval training (HIIT) and provides a more dynamic exercise.
Resistance Mechanism
Magnetic Resistance: Smooth and peaceful, permitting accurate resistance changes.
Fricton Resistance: Less costly but can be noisy and less exact.
Air Resistance: Uses a fan to create resistance, supplying a natural cycling feel.
Adjustability
Seat and Handlebar: Ensure they can be adapted to fit your body comfortably.
Resistance Levels: Look for a bike with a vast array of resistance settings.
Extra Features
Heart Rate Monitor: Helps track fitness progress.
LCD Display: Provides exercise information like speed, distance, and calories burned.
Integrated Workouts: Pre-programmed routines for variety and Exercise Cycle for Home benefit.

Creating a Home Cycling Routine
A well-structured biking routine can assist you accomplish your physical fitness goals effectively. Here's a detailed guide to developing an efficient home biking workout:
Warm-Up (5-10 minutes).
Low Resistance: Start with a gentle trip to heat up your muscles.
Dynamic Stretches: Include leg swings, hip circles, and arm circles to increase versatility.
Main Workout (20-60 minutes).
Steady-State Cycling: Maintain a moderate pace and resistance for a continual cardio exercise.
Interval Training: Alternate between high-intensity sprints and low-intensity recovery durations for a more tough session.
Hill Climbs: Increase resistance to mimic riding uphill, appealing different muscle groups.
Resistance Training: Use the bike's resistance to develop muscle strength, concentrating on leg and core muscles.
Cool Down (5-10 minutes).
Low Resistance: Gradually reduce intensity to cool off your heart rate.
Static Stretches: Hold stretches for 15-30 seconds to improve flexibility and decrease muscle discomfort.
Frequency and Duration.
Beginners: Aim for 2-3 sessions each week, each lasting 20-30 minutes.
Intermediate: Increase to 3-4 sessions weekly, 30-45 minutes per session.
Advanced: Aim for 4-5 sessions per week, 45-60 minutes per session.
Sample Home Cycling Workouts.
Here are two sample workouts to get you started:.
Novice Steady-State Workout.
Warm-Up: 5 minutes at low resistance.
Main Workout: 20 minutes at moderate resistance.
Cool Down: 5 minutes at low resistance.
Overall Duration: 30 minutes.
Intermediate Interval Training Workout.
Warm-Up: 10 minutes at low resistance.
Main Workout: 30 minutes alternating 1 minute of high resistance with 2 minutes of low resistance.
Cool Down: 10 minutes at low resistance.
Overall Duration: 50 minutes.
Frequently asked questions.
Q: Can I use an exercise bike if I have knee problems? A: Yes, biking is a low-impact activity that can be gentle on the knees. Nevertheless, it's important to change the seat and handlebars to guarantee appropriate posture and alignment to avoid stress.
Q: How frequently should I clean my stationary bicycle? A: It's suggested to clean your exercise bike after each use to preserve hygiene and avoid rust. Use a wet fabric to wipe down the seat, handlebars, and frame. For much deeper cleansing, describe the manufacturer's standards.
Q: Can I utilize an exercise bike for weight reduction? A: Absolutely! Cycling burns calories and can be an effective part of a weight-loss plan. Combine it with a well balanced diet plan and other forms of exercise for optimal results.
Q: Do I need unique clothes to utilize an exercise bike? A: While not strictly essential, wearing comfortable, moisture-wicking clothes can enhance your exercise experience. Biking shorts and a moisture-wicking top are good choices.
Q: Can I utilize my stationary bicycle for strength training? A: Yes, by using higher resistance levels, you can engage your leg and core muscles, constructing strength and endurance. Include resistance training into your regimen for a more comprehensive workout.
